Cross-Border Payment Efficiency

Efficiency

Cross-border payment efficiency, within cryptocurrency, options, and derivatives, represents the minimization of total cost—including fees, exchange rates, and processing times—associated with transferring value internationally. This is particularly relevant given the inherent friction in traditional correspondent banking systems, which often involve multiple intermediaries and opaque pricing structures. Cryptocurrency-based solutions aim to reduce these inefficiencies through decentralized networks and programmable money, potentially lowering transaction costs and increasing speed, especially for smaller value transfers. The impact on derivative settlements is significant, as faster and cheaper payments can reduce counterparty risk and improve capital utilization.
